How do Wetlands Purify Water?
Wetlands play a crucial role in purifying water. When water runs through wetlands, the vegetation and soils in the wetlands act as natural filters that remove pollutants, excess nutrients, and sediments from the water. The roots of wetland plants absorb nutrients, and the sediments in the wetlands hold contaminants. As water flows through the wetlands, the contaminants stick to the plant root, and the sediment is trapped. The microbes present in the wetland soils break down organic matter and other pollutants, producing clean water.
Wetland Types
There are three main types of wetlands; including marshes, swamps, and bogs. Marshes are wetlands with herbaceous plants, Swamps are wetlands with trees, and Bogs are wetlands characterized by acid-loving plants and spongy ground. All these three wetlands types play a significant role in purifying water.

Q2. What types of contaminants can wetlands filter out?
Wetlands can filter out various types of contaminants such as metals, pesticides, organic matter, and excess nutrients like nitrogen and phosphorus.
